## Deployment

Quick note on retry semantics before you approve: Hookpipe retries failed webhook deliveries with exponential backoff and jitter, capped at six attempts. A 410 from the receiver short-circuits retries and disables the endpoint. Dead-lettered payloads land in the replay queue for 72 hours. All of this is tunable per environment, and the deploy script bakes these in at build time. The production defaults are as follows.

service settings:
WENATH_PIN=5007
WENATH_METRICS_HOST=metrics.wenath.tolvaqlabs.corp
WENATH_LOG_LEVEL=debug
WENATH_TENANT=rusox

## Runbook: Tallyvane Metrics Sidecar

The Tallyvane sidecar aggregates per-pod metrics and flushes to the Glimmerfall store every 15 seconds. If flushes stall, restart the sidecar container only — never the main pod. Check buffer depth first; anything over 10k points means the store endpoint is throttling. To query the Glimmerfall admin API for throttle status, use the key below.

gateway credential: kto23_LX9A4ys6i4nzHtpOLNLodKK

## Stale-Branch Bot (Tidysweep)

Tidysweep scans every repository in the Fernworks org nightly, flags branches with no commits in ninety days, and opens a deletion proposal rather than deleting outright. It authenticates to the internal repo-metadata service on each run, and that call fails closed — no key, no scan. When configuring a local instance, supply the service key shown below.

app token of bahaf-tajeg = zpat23_SjjsllwiLmXbtS65veZaV47